Clutch Masters 03-05 Dodge Neon 2.4L SRT-4 Turbo 725 Twin-Disc Race Clutch Kit w/Steel Flywheel
Clutch Masters
Clutch Masters 03-05 Dodge Neon 2.4L SRT-4 Turbo 725 Twin-Disc Race Clutch Kit w/Steel Flywheel
$1,440.00
- SKU:
- 05086-TD7R-S
- UPC:
- 05086-TD7R-S
Related Products
An relatable roduct